/** * Require all classes inside the directory * * @return void */ protected function requireAllClasses() { $this->output->progressStart($this->requirer->getCount()); foreach ($this->requirer->requireOnceAllFiles() as $file) { $this->output->progressAdvance(); $this->info(" Required : [{$file}]"); } $this->output->progressFinish(); }
public function test_require_once_method() { iterator_to_array($this->_object->requireOnceAllFiles()); $this->assertContains('Reshadman\\EloquentFaster\\FasterModel', $classes = get_declared_classes()); $this->assertContains('Reshadman\\EloquentFaster\\EloquentCacheClearCommand', $classes); }